What must be included in a flight operation report?

  1. The purpose of the flight

  2. The flight duration only

  3. Temperature and weather conditions

  4. All operational occurrences during flight

The correct answer is: All operational occurrences during flight

A flight operation report is an essential document that captures comprehensive information about a particular flight. The inclusion of all operational occurrences during the flight is crucial for several reasons. First, recording operational occurrences helps in assessing the overall performance and safety of the flight. This information can be vital for future flight planning and for identifying any irregularities or incidents that may need further investigation or analysis. Comprehensive data ensures that operators can learn from each flight and implement necessary improvements. Second, these reports serve as valuable records for regulatory compliance and safety audits. By documenting every operational occurrence, the report provides a clear history of the flight, which can be critical when addressing any issues or concerns raised post-flight. Lastly, this practice aligns with industry standards and expectations for operational transparency, allowing for enhanced accountability and reliability in flight operations. Such detailed documentation is crucial for maintaining safety and efficiency in both military and civilian aviation contexts.
